“The criticism on this offense should come at me,” – Eagles HC Nick Sirianni makes defensive change at coach, and takes blame for offense

626 days ago

The Eagles may have qualified for the playoffs, but the team is on a slide, losing three in a row.

Head coach Nick Sirianni has made a crucial change in defense replacing DC Sean Desai with Matt Patricia.

“We have to put the players in more positions to create explosive plays,” Sirianni said.

“But make no mistake about it, this offense is being run the exact same way the offense was run last year and the year before that. This offense is my offense; right? This is my offense. So, the criticism on the offense I think unfairly goes to Brian. Brian calls the plays. Brian calls the plays. It unfairly goes to Brian.”

The Eagles will want to snap their winless streak when they take on an improved New York Giants team in week 16.

“The criticism on this offense should come at me because this is my offense. I was hired to do a job here and got hired because I was successful as an offensive coordinator with our schemes and the different things that we did to coach players and help players win.

The 10-4 Eagles will want to keep the pressure on the 11-3 49ers and Ravens, who play each other this round.

“I’m committed to that. Like I said, the criticism should come at me, and I think it unfairly goes at Brian a lot of the times because he’s calling the plays.”

The changes defensively are not a huge surprise, but what about offense, an area that also needs looking after.
